bedfellow

/ˌbɛdˈfɛloʊ/
IPA guide

Other forms: bedfellows

Definitions of bedfellow
  1. noun
    a person with whom you share a bed
  2. noun
    a temporary associate
    “politics makes strange bedfellows
    see moresee less
    type of:
    associate
    a person who joins with others in some activity or endeavor
